Investment Summary

📎 Investment Objective

The 3EDGE Dynamic Fixed Income ETF (EDGF) seeks to provide current income and capital preservation by investing in a diversified portfolio of fixed income securities.

🎯 Investment Strategy

The fund employs a dynamic, multi-asset investment approach to navigate changing market conditions. It allocates across a range of fixed income asset classes, including government bonds, corporate bonds, and other debt instruments, with the goal of generating consistent income and managing risk.

✨ Key Features

  • Actively managed fixed income portfolio with flexible allocation across sectors
  • Seeks to provide current income and capital preservation
  • Utilizes a dynamic, multi-asset approach to adapt to market conditions
  • Diversified exposure to a range of fixed income asset classes

⚠️ Primary Risks

  • Interest rate risk: The fund's holdings may decline in value when interest rates rise
  • Credit risk: The fund is exposed to the risk of default or deterioration in credit quality of its bond holdings
  • Liquidity risk: Some of the fund's investments may be difficult to sell at an advantageous time or price
  • Diversification risk: The fund's performance may be more volatile than a more diversified portfolio

👤 Best For

The 3EDGE Dynamic Fixed Income ETF may be suitable for investors seeking current income and capital preservation, with a moderate risk tolerance and a medium-term investment horizon. It may be a suitable core fixed income holding or complement to a broader investment portfolio.
